Merisel, Inc. Wins Business Turnaround of the Year at the 2011 American Business Awards

NEW YORK, June 20,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- Merisel, Inc. (OTC: MSEL) operating under its principal brand Coloredge New York - Los Angeles, a leading provider of visual communications and brand imaging solutions, was awarded "Business Turnaround of the Year" last night at the 9th Annual American Business Awards Ceremony, in recognition of its agility to adapt, grow, and maintain its commitment to delivering solid results, despite prevailing economic turbulence.

The American Business Awards, part of The Stevie Awards program, honors the achievements and contributions of US-based businesses and their employees.  Awards were presented in over 40 categories and more than 2,800 entries were received from organizations of all sizes in virtually every industry.  Merisel itself was a finalist for ten awards in seven categories, including "Best Overall Company of the Year," "Business Innovation of the Year," and "Turnaround Executive of the Year."

The distinction of "Business Turnaround of the Year" is awarded to the company that showed significant operational and financial improvement in 2010 over 2009. The winning nomination stated:

[Merisel] ended 2009 with a 26% decline in net sales vs. 2008 and an operating loss of $9.3 million (adjusted to exclude one-time non-cash expenses).  We finished 2010 with 15.9% year-on-year revenue growth and strong operating income of $1.5 million, resulting in a turnaround of $10.8 million.  Undoubtedly, [Merisel] achieved these results through persistent adherence to our three core tenets:  Consistently creating superior value for our customers, focusing our operations on efficiency, and instilling a culture defined by high-performance and excellence.

About Merisel, Inc. / Coloredge New York - Los Angeles

Merisel, Inc. (OTC: MSEL.PK), operating under its principal brand Coloredge New York - Los Angeles, is a leading visual communications services company trusted by many of the world's most brand-conscious, consumer-oriented companies to conceive and execute visual solutions that maintain and enhance their brand image and support key marketing objectives.  Merisel provides a broad portfolio of digital and graphic services to clients in the retail, manufacturing, beverage, cosmetic, advertising, entertainment, and consumer packaged goods industries.  With sales offices in New York City, Atlanta, Los Angeles, and Portland, Oregon, and production bi-coastal production operations in New York, New Jersey, Atlanta, and Los Angeles, Merisel's unique combination of creative designers, skilled technicians, cutting-edge technology, and proprietary processes constitute a distinct competitive advantage, allowing Merisel to bring our clients' visions to life in invigorating ways, from creative conception to impeccable execution, implementation, and delivery.
